It's a pleasure to e-meet you!

"Step out of your comfort zone" has been the guiding theme of my life. After a six-year career as an academic consultant, I co-founded Walnut Education — a platform that connects consultants and students, much like Airbnb connects hosts and guests. Our team built a comprehensive online marketplace from scratch.

While I initially focused on product design at Walnut, my time there ignited my passion for coding. As we developed new features, I actively contributed to building the platform, learning programming through hands-on experience.

In 2024, I took a leap and enrolled in App Academy to deepen my technical expertise. Now, I'm dedicated to building my software engineering portfolio and am eagerly exploring exciting job opportunities in the tech industry.

Education

NYU AppAcademy
Sarah
View Resume

Skills

  • React
  • Redux
  • Angular
  • CSS
  • HTML
  • Python
  • JavaScript
  • TypeScript
  • Flask
  • Express
  • SQLAlchemy
  • SQLite
  • PostgreSQL
  • Sequelize
  • AWS
  • GitHub
  • Git
  • Visual Studio Code
  • Docker
  • Render

Projects

Walnut Education

Walnut Education is a platform I engineered from the ground up in collaboration with two other engineers, with the mission to promote transparency and provide diverse choices in the college admissions consulting industry. Inspired by the Airbnb model, this platform connects students seeking application guidance with a variety of consultants, creating an intuitive space where students act as guests and consultants as hosts.

The platform is packed with essential features, including an advanced search functionality, real-time chat for instant communication, payment processing to simplify transactions, and a review system that helps students make informed decisions. We successfully registered over 121 consultants, offering a broad selection of expertise to match students' unique needs.

Our efforts were recognized when Walnut Education ranked among Y Combinator's top 10% of applicants in 2021, further validating the platform's potential to reshape the consulting experience by seamlessly integrating complex functionalities into a user-centered approach. This project demonstrates my ability to build full-fledged platforms that address real-world needs and deliver a seamless and transparent consulting process.




Hello World

HelloWorld is a dynamic and feature-rich travel planning application that I developed as my capstone project during the App Academy coding bootcamp. Inspired by Wanderlog, I built this full-stack solo project within just two weeks.

The frontend of the application is powered by React, while the backend is supported by Flask. I incorporated a variety of technologies, including Leaflet for interactive maps, JavaScript, Python, Redux, SQLite3, PostgreSQL and AWS S3 for image storage,. AWS allows seamless image uploads and retrieval, enhancing user experience by providing fast and reliable media handling.

One of the standout features of HelloWorld is its AI-powered travel assistant, which provides intelligent itinerary suggestions and personalized recommendations. By utilizing AI-based fetching, the application helps users plan trips with real-time insights and optimized travel routes effortlessly.

This project highlights my ability to integrate complex tools and frameworks to deliver a fully functional, user-friendly travel planning application.




Artisan Alley

Artisan Alley is an e-commerce platform modeled after Etsy, developed collaboratively by me and three team members. This full-stack application highlights our ability to work effectively as a team, creating a user-friendly marketplace for handmade and vintage goods.

The frontend is built using React, while the backend is powered by Flask. Throughout the development, we utilized various technologies, including Python, JavaScript, CSS, HTML, SQLAlchemy, and Redux.

This project demonstrates our collective skills in building a functional and polished platform, showcasing both our teamwork and technical expertise in full-stack development.




aABnB

This full-stack solo project is a dynamic web application developed during my time at App Academy, showcasing my skills in both frontend and backend development over a 2-week period.

The frontend is built using React, while the backend is powered by Express.js. Throughout the development, I utilized a variety of technologies, including JavaScript, Node.js, CSS, CSS Grid, HTML, SQLite3, PostgreSQL, and Redux. The application features full CRUD functionality for both reviews and listings, allowing users to create, read, update, and delete reviews and listings seamlessly within the platform.

This project demonstrates my technical expertise in full-stack development and highlights my ability to independently build a feature-rich, responsive application with a seamless user experience across multiple devices.

Get In Touch

I am actively seeking full-stack software engineering opportunities where I can contribute my expertise in building dynamic, user-centered applications.

Please feel free to reach out if you have any questions or would like to discuss potential collaborations. Looking forward to connecting!